Just letting those in the Maryborough area know that there will be some warbirds from Toowoomba venturing upto Maryborough QLD for the weekend conducting Adventure flights for those willing to occupy the spare seat and enjoy a flight in these old birds.

 

A T-28 will be there from Midday Approx. toomorrow (FRIDAY 29th May)

 

Also a CAC Winjeel will be there toomorrow. also there will be possibly another one if not two T-28 Trojans a Yak-52 and a Nanchang ariving on Saturday. So there will be a group of us making some noise and filling the air with the sound of round.

Sorry for not replying to yours before this but had already left for the trip north. I was in the ground crew ute on the way up and back.

 

Had a great time. The weather was little ordinary at times but managed to get a few shots in, especially Saturday. The adventure operators did well, and the response was great from the locals.

 

A big thanks to the Maryborough Aero Club for their hospitality too in both providing food and their facilities saturday evening for a bit of a relax before heading back to our Accom.

 

operating the adventure flights we had 1 T-28 Trojan a CAC Winjeel and nanchang CJ-6A.

 

Also from Toowoomba stables we had arrive another 2 T-28's, 1 Yak 52, 1 PAC CT4-E Airtrainer and a Cessna 182. So there was a few of us to make a bit of noise.
